Start with custody and withdrawal mechanics, because that’s where small-print becomes real money. A reputable broker-style platform typically explains whether client funds are held in segregated accounts, how card/transfer withdrawals are processed, and what triggers manual review. Then come the technical basics: SSL/TLS across the site, plus optional 2FA (authenticator-app 2FA is stronger than SMS). Practical checks you can do without “trusting” anyone: (1) read withdrawal and fees pages end-to-end and look for vague discretion clauses; (2) confirm the legal entity matches the Terms and privacy policy; (3) check whether identity verification is required before withdrawal (KYC is friction, but it’s also a legitimacy tell); (4) search the claimed regulator’s register for the exact entity name; (5) test whether support offers a traceable ticket number and written answers on timelines.

A broker-like venue earns credibility through product disclosure more than product breadth. Clean fee schedules, plain-English risk disclosure around leverage, and a clear execution model (market maker vs. agency, typical spreads/commissions, and swap/financing costs) are the signals that matter. When those items are hidden behind account creation, it becomes harder to compare the platform to peers—and harder to judge “legit vs. improvisation.” For context, a transparent Willow Capitwick trading platform presentation would normally let you review key terms, product specs, and basic legal documentation before you hand over identity documents or deposit details.
Available Assets
In this broker category, the usual retail line-up starts with FX pairs and index CFDs, then branches into commodities and equity CFDs; some platforms also add crypto-linked instruments depending on jurisdiction. What matters is not just whether an instrument is “available,” but whether margin requirements, contract sizes, and trading hours are clearly published and consistent across documents. If you’re weighing whether is Willow Capitwick a legit choice for your style—day trading indices, hedging FX exposure, or holding positions overnight—focus on disclosed costs (spreads, commissions, swaps) and the platform’s stated protections, such as negative balance protection where applicable. Any ambiguity here is a risk-management issue, not a cosmetic one.

Online reputation can help, but only when you read it like a credit analyst, not like a fan club. Review aggregators and app-store comments are noisy: incentives exist for overly positive posts, competitors sometimes seed negative ones, and the silent majority rarely writes anything at all. So for the Willow Capitwick scam or legit debate, triangulation beats scrolling—compare visible user feedback with (where applicable) regulator complaint channels, community discussions in trading forums, and whether the company itself provides a documented dispute path. Pay special attention to patterns around withdrawals, account verification, and sudden rule changes; those are more diagnostic than complaints about “slippage” after a volatile session.
